The first step in box manufacture is the design phase. This is where the dimensions, structure, and material of the box are determined based on the specific requirements of the product it will contain. The design must take into account factors such as the weight of the product, how it will be shipped, and any special requirements such as ventilation or insulation. Once the design is finalized, it is time to move on to the next step in the manufacturing process.

Next, the materials for the box are selected. Cardboard is the most common material used in box manufacture due to its affordability, durability, and recyclability. However, there are different types of cardboard available, each with its own strengths and weaknesses. For example, corrugated cardboard is made up of three layers of paper – an outer layer, a fluted inner layer, and another outer layer – which provides extra strength and protection for heavy or fragile items. On the other hand, solid cardboard is made up of a single layer of paper and is best suited for lightweight items.

After the materials have been selected, they are cut and scored according to the design specifications. The cutting process is usually done by a machine that can accurately cut the cardboard sheets to the required dimensions. The scoring process involves making small cuts on the cardboard to help it fold easily and accurately when assembled. These cuts are essential in ensuring that the box can be folded and assembled correctly without tearing or bending.

Once the cardboard sheets have been cut and scored, they are fed into a machine that will fold, glue, and assemble them into the final box shape. This machine is programmed to fold the cardboard along the scored lines, apply adhesive to the necessary areas, and press the pieces together to form a sturdy and functional box. The machine works quickly and efficiently, producing box after box with consistent quality and precision.

After the boxes have been assembled, they are usually inspected for quality control purposes. Any defects or issues with the boxes are identified and corrected before they are packaged and shipped to the customer. Quality control is essential to ensure that the boxes meet the required standards and will protect the products they contain during transportation and storage.
